Traveling by truck: The journey continues by truck as the vaccine makes its way through Jinotega, Nicaragua, a town one hundred miles northwest of Managua. It took ten years of research and sixteen years of development before scientists could make the vaccine available to children. (Bill and Melinda Gates Foundation)
